Citations
2 citations on file for this inspection.
1910.22 A01
- Issued
- Nov 18, 2019
- Abate by
- Dec 17, 2019
- Penalty
- Initial $6,819 · Current $0 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.22(a)(1): (1) All places of employment, passageways, storerooms, service rooms, and walking-working surfaces are kept in a clean, orderly, and sanitary condition. On or about July 22, 2019, in the West Permanent Mold area, the 115E1948 sand molds and clamps were staged on the floor for pouring in a manner that would not allow the employees to safely walk around and between the other sand molds while carrying a hand ladle containing hot aluminum exposing employees to burns.

1910.132 A
- Issued
- Nov 18, 2019
- Abate by
- Feb 3, 2020
- Penalty
- Initial $6,819 · Current $6,819
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.132(a): Application. Protective equipment, including personal protective equipment for eyes, face, head, and extremities, protective clothing, respiratory devices, and protective shields and barriers, shall be provided, used, and maintained in a sanitary and reliable condition wherever it is necessary by reason of hazards of processes or environment, chemical hazards, radiological hazards, or mechanical irritants encountered in a manner capable of causing injury or impairment in the function of any part of the body through absorption, inhalation or physical contact. On or about July 22, 2019, in the West Permanent Mold area, employees only utilized basic protection and spat when performing pouring of molten aluminum activities exposing employees to burn hazard. For employees in a hazardous zone (such as near a furnace or ladle containing molten metal) addition application specific clothing and ppe is required. Options include, but not limit: coats, jackets, aprons, cape, sleeve(s) and bib, leggings, and chaps.
